Δ excitations and shell-model information in heavy-ion, charge-exchange reactions

P. A. Deutchman, K. M. Maung, J. W. Norbury, J. O. Rasmussen, and L. W. Townsend
Phys. Rev. C 34, 2377(R) – Published 1 December 1986
PDFExport Citation

Abstract

We calculate total cross sections for coherent pion production using localized plane-wave approximations for the shell-structure of valence nucleons that are excited to Δ particles in the intermediate state in the (C12, B12) and (C12, N12) charge-exchange, heavy-ion reactions. We find comparable agreement to projectile downshift data for C12(C12, B12)N12. Then we improve the formalism by replacing the localized plane wave bound states with harmonic oscillator states which are imbedded in a multipole expansion approach and calculate pion differential cross sections to test for the sensitivity of the spectra to the single-particle mass parameter.
